Output 3a08d7785c47d7a5fe1e7d0c02017b88fe10fd35bb617eaf6a442c1a58275012:0

value
170283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e557e5423bf25dd41720483791530841e448e591 OP_EQUAL
address
3NbfxZZccMMm2C8WF5AfAE2JVSfyaP9dHg
transaction
3a08d7785c47d7a5fe1e7d0c02017b88fe10fd35bb617eaf6a442c1a58275012
spent
true